    Toward Personal Affordable Exoskeletons with Force Control Capabilities

    No full text
    This paper presents a design concept for affordable exoskeletons without renouncing to advanced interaction control modalities based on force control technologies. Affordability is reached by (1) lowering the motor requirements, thanks to a smart mechanical design, (2) lowering the sensing requirements, thanks to extensive use of microprocessor DMA, and (3) using low-cost computational platforms. A main finding of this work is that by lowering the motor requirements the exoskeleton improves its inherent force controllability
